The National Monuments Service's description
Internal diameter 34m
This univallate rath has been completely enclosed by a fieldbank that curves with the site, thus giving it a bivallate look. The circular area is enclosed by a well-defined earthen bank and exterior fosse. The maximum external height of the enclosing bank measures 1.3m and internally .7m. On average the width of the bank at the base measures 5m. The entrance may have been to the E where a 3m wide gap provides access to the interior.
The above description is derived from C. Toal, ‘North Kerry Archaeological Survey’. Dingle. Brandon in association with FAS Training and Employment Authority (1995), no. 266. In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
